Life Science Animation

Life science processes present a specific visualization challenge: the most important things that happen in a cell therapy workflow, a bioprocessing run, or a high content imaging assay are invisible to any camera. They occur at scales, speeds, or inside systems that physical documentation cannot capture. We produce 3D animations for life science instruments and workflows including cell counting and viability analysis for cell therapy and bioprocessing, high content imaging and phenotypic screening, multimode detection, nucleic acid purification, and flow cytometry. Our life science work includes productions for Revvity across the Cellaca, Opera Phenix Optiq, and VICTOR Kira platforms. Photorealistic Product Renders

A photorealistic 3D render of a diagnostic instrument or life science device gives you consistent, accurate visuals before the product is ready for photography - and often long after, when a physical shoot would be impractical or too costly to repeat. The same 3D model that powers a product launch animation can generate hero images for product pages, renders for printed datasheets and brochures, exhibition panel graphics for trade fairs, and visual assets for global campaign materials. Every output shares the same model, the same lighting, and the same level of technical accuracy. For IVD and life science products with complex geometry, internal components, and multiple configuration variants, a 3D asset library is significantly more flexible than a photography session.
